Output cfd9c3fc7a7b4394a69da063a5257c0dc29b6492a8b799b9ba5dbab4d1a35d06:0

value
17887921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d810da0ec828a795f73905a5d25112227cdece OP_EQUAL
address
3R1o4ye9wBVYkyHG6kxJrvyicbTnDmKF7e
transaction
cfd9c3fc7a7b4394a69da063a5257c0dc29b6492a8b799b9ba5dbab4d1a35d06
confirmations
448009
spent
true